5. Your Rights (ARCO Rights)
Under Peruvian Law No. 29733, you possess the rights of Access, Rectification, Cancellation, and Opposition (ARCO Rights) regarding your personal data. You can exercise these rights at any time by:
-
Requesting a summary of the data we hold about you (Access).
-
Updating incorrect or outdated information (Rectification).
-
Requesting the deletion of your data once the travel service is completed (Cancellation).
-
Objecting to the use of your data for specific secondary purposes, such as newsletter marketing (Opposition).
